ABSTRACT
This research studied the nature, problem and prospect of the new product developed in the banking industry from 1990-2003.
In this research work, the researcher chose four of the products and measures the extent to which they have been able to satisfy the customers. The product selected are smart card, international money transfer, educational scheme and integrated banking network transaction.
Data for this research were collected through questionnaire and interviews by bank customers and the review of existing literature on the topic using simple random procedure and the descriptive method of research. The data so collected were analysed using the simple percentage and the formulated hypothesis were tested with chi-square (x2) method.
Some of the findings are the nature of the new product can measured in terms of accessibility, speed, timeliness, simplicity and reliability.
Customers who patronize the new product are majority those who want money transfer both locally and internationally customers derived high level of satisfaction from the new products.
Inadequate infrastructural level in our banking industry and high cost of installing them contributed to the problem of the new product.
Based on the findings, the following were recommended banks should come together and establish a common data communication satellite to minimize constant problems.
A parallel organization that was supplying electricity in competition with NEPA should be allowed to evolved so that an efficient supply of electricity can be ensured.
Finally, since this study alone cannot exhaustive of this vital subject, it is recommended for further studies.
